This Leicester based tax advisory firm has a new opening for a Private Client Tax Advisory Manager to join their team. Employees benefit from flexible working arrangements and comprehensive development programmes. A commitment to diversity, continuous learning, and employee well-being creates an environment where individuals can thrive and grow professionally.
As Private Client Tax Advisory Manager you will have responsibility for providing technical advice across a wide range of projects including wealth planning, shareholder exit, de-mergers and owner managed businesses. You will provide advisory and consultancy services for private client services tax projects to UHNWI and HNWI clients, business owners and Directors focusing on the Midlands market. The role will involve working on a variety of advisory projects and technical assignments.
Whilst the core role is private client tax based, you will have knowledge of key issues across other taxes, and will build your knowledge of other taxes and wider commercial issues. You will provide technical training and support to junior staff to develop the wider advisory capabilities of the whole team. Managing all aspects of delivering complex private client service planning projects, from start to completion. Ensuring tax quality at all times.
Project management to ensure individual assignments are completed within budget. You will have solid private client advisory experience, proven experience in client handling and project management, and proven tax experience in producing high quality work.
